I made a lemon raspberry tart the other day, and thought I would share the recipe (via Lianne) and some free printables;-)
Recipe:
175g Flour
215g Caster Sugar
75g Butter
200ml Double Cream
Salt
7 Lemons
7 Eggs
Icing Sugar
Raspberries
1. Soften the butter and then blend it along with the flour, 40g of sugar, 1 egg yolk (save the egg white for later) and a pinch of salt. Add a tablespoon of warm water. Put it in the fridge to firm up for half an hour.
2. Filling:
Squeeze the lemons until you have 275ml of juice and whisk it into the 6 eggs, 175g of sugar and 200ml of double cream.
3. Roll out your chilled pastry on a floured surface and line your cast iron pan or pastry cases (or pastry case if you’re making one large tart). Brush with the leftover egg white and bake for 20 minutes.
4. Pour the filling into the pastry shell and stud with raspberries. Bake for 25-30 minutes. Set aside to cool.
5. Add more raspberries on top (I also used blueberries) and dust with icing sugar before serving.
* Tip: You can freeze your fresh raspberries, don’t let them go bad in the fridge!
